The fans do run on temp.  However, the factory drives use Apple firmware 
and a temp sensor on the drive instead of using SMART. Also, there is no 
industry standard for drive temp sensors, so they all have different 
connectors.

Other World Computing discovered the snag when they were working on 
upgrade kits for the Mid-2011 iMacs.  Apple sends temp info in a 
non-standard format.  They came up with a solution, but they're keeping 
it to themselves.  They will, however, upgrade your iMac to dual 
internal SSD's for you, and guarantee that they pass the Apple Hardware 
Test and that they work with the fan control.

There is a software utility you can buy, but there is a lot of concern 
about trusting it to do the right thing, all of the time.
